Is Litecoin a Better Investment Option over Bitcoin?

  Litecoin is one of the first Bitcoin forks which were launched in late 2011 by former Google and Coinbase engineer Charlie Lee. To create this crypto, Lee copied the Bitcoin codebase, increased the total supply, and increased the speed at which new blocks are added to the blockchain. It was mainly constructed as a lighter alternative of BTC, but a faster and scalable one. What Makes Monero the Best Investment Option?

Image
  Monero (XMR)- a fork of Bytecoin is a secure, private, and untraceable digital currency that is built on the Cryptonote protocol using Ring Signatures. Proof of Work (PoW) mechanism called CryptoNight issues new coins that provide incentives to miners for securing the network and validating transactions. Originally launched in April 2014 as BitMonero, Monero aka XM is called a privacy coin because it has inherent privacy features. Unlike most other famous blockchains, Monero’s blockchain is designed as opaque where no one else can see the account’s balance or history of transactions. Transactions with Monero are comparatively faster than Bitcoin ones. With a target block time of 2 minutes and a safe number of confirmations around ten, XMR proves to be better than Bitcoins.   Ethereum is a blockchain-based computing platform that enables developers to build and deploy decentralized applications (Dapps)—meaning the ones not run by any centralized authority. You can create a Dapp for which the users of that particular application are the decision-making authority. ETHEREUM FEATURES: Ether: Ether is Ethereum’s cryptocurrency. Smart contracts: Ethereum allows the development and deployment of smart contracts. Ethereum Virtual Machine: ETH provides the underlying technology—the architecture and the software—which allows you to understand smart contracts and allows you to interact with the same. Decentralized applications (Dapps): ETH allows you to create consolidated applications, called decentralized applications also known as a Dapp (also spelt DAPP, App, or DApp) for short.
